## Read-Replica Lag Alarm

New folks: the ReplicaLagHigh alarm covers the Ostrel reporting replicas. It fires when lag exceeds 90 seconds for five minutes. Most triggers come from the nightly Bramwell export job, which is expected and auto-resolves. Do not fail over the replica yourself — that requires the data-platform lead's approval and a change ticket. If the alarm persists past 20 minutes with no export running, write to the platform inbox.

billing contact of yahip-yadup = eliax.druix@zemvarworks.corp

## v3.8.0 — Audit-Log Viewer

- Added tamper-evidence column showing per-entry hash chain verification status.
- Export now requires the `audit.export` scope and records the exporting session in the log itself.
- Fixed pagination gap that could skip entries written during a page fetch.
- Redaction rules for the Quillmark tenant are now applied at query time, not render time.

All changes were reviewed against the internal logging standard. Accountability for this release rests with the engineer named below.

named custodian: Brivan Eliath Quenox Frador

### Encoding Detection

When a user uploads a text file, the Glyphwell platform runs it through the Charscope detection service before handing it to your plugin. Charscope samples the first 64 KB, scores candidate encodings, and normalizes everything to UTF-8, so your plugin never needs its own detection logic. Ambiguous files are tagged so you can prompt the user. To call Charscope directly during local plugin development, authenticate with the sandbox key below.

service key, tadup-yagep: kto23_Eoog5Djh7wQNnUcbvpYZZfG

Ticket: Staging env misconfigured for Siftgate bloom filter

The bloom layer in front of the Pellet KV store is rejecting all lookups in staging because the env file was copied from the dev template without credentials. False-positive tuning values are fine; only the auth line is missing. To unblock the weekly demo, the Pellet admission secret must be set on the following line.

env line for yaguf-fajop: LEDGER_TOKEN13=fb08984397349